Door Glass Repair: Essential Guide for Homeowners
Door glass is an essential component in both residential and industrial properties, offering security, light, and visual appeal. Nevertheless, it is not uncommon for door glass to become harmed due to accidents, weather, or use and tear. Comprehending how to effectively repair or replace door glass can conserve house owners time and money while ensuring their residential or commercial property stays safe and secure. This article functions as a comprehensive guide to door glass repair, covering numerous kinds of door glass, tools required for repairs, common concerns, and often asked concerns.

Types of Door Glass
Before starting a repair upvc door project, it is vital for house owners to comprehend the various types of door glass.
| Kind Of Door Glass | Description |
|---|---|
| Single Pane | Made up of one layer of glass, single-pane doors are one of the most basic and economical alternative however provide less insulation. |
| Double Pane | Consisting of two layers of glass separated by an insulating area, double-pane doors are more energy-efficient and assist manage indoor temperature level. |
| Tempered Glass | This type of glass is treated with heat to increase its strength and security. It shatters into small, less damaging pieces when broken. |
| Laminated Glass | Laminated glass consists of 2 layers of glass with a plastic interlayer that holds the pieces together if broken, providing enhanced safety and sound insulation. |
| Frosted Glass | This glass is dealt with to produce a clear appearance, enabling light in while preserving personal privacy. It can be single or double-pane. |
Comprehending the kind of glass used in your door can affect your approach to repair or replacement.
Common Door Glass Issues
Numerous common issues might occur with door glass, requiring repair.
- Fractures and Chips: Minor damage can typically be repaired if it does not compromise the structural stability of the glass.
- Broken Glass: Complete shattering or big breaks will generally need replacement.
- Seal Failure: In double-pane doors, a broken seal can cause moisture accumulation between the panes, leading to fogging or condensation.
- Scratches: Surface scratches can often be polished out however may require expert treatment for deeper scratches.
Steps for Repairing Door Glass
1. Examine the Damage
Before any repair starts, assess the level of the damage. If the damage is extensive (e.g., shattered glass), it might be best to replace the whole panel. For small cracks or chips, repairs can frequently be made with the best materials.
2. Collect Required Tools and Materials
To successfully repair double glazing window door glass, property owners will need the following tools:
- Safety safety glasses and gloves
- Utility knife
- Glass cleaner
- Glass adhesive (for little cracks)
- Replacement glass panel (for substantial damage)
- Putty knife
- Caulk weapon and silicone sealant (if necessary)
3. Eliminate Old Glass (if applicable)
If replacing the glass, thoroughly remove the damaged panel. Use an utility knife to cut through any caulking or seals. Lift the shattered glass out thoroughly to prevent injury.
4. Tidy the Frame
As soon as the old glass is gotten rid of, tidy the frame completely to make sure a tight seal for the brand-new glass. Use glass cleaner and a putty knife to remove any particles.
5. Install New Glass or Repair Existing Damage
For small chips or fractures, use glass adhesive and push the edges together. For total replacements, follow these steps:
- Cut the brand-new glass panel to size (if needed).
- Use a bead of silicone sealant around the frame.
- Position the glass panel in the frame, pressing it securely into the sealant.
6. Seal and Secure
As soon as the new glass is positioned, ensure it is effectively sealed. Additional caulking might be applied around the edges for included assistance. Enable adequate drying time as specified by the adhesive or sealant maker.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. Can I windows repair door glass myself?
Yes, minor damage can normally be fixed by homeowners. Nevertheless, for substantial damage or if dealing with dangerous products, employing a professional is recommended.
2. How do I understand if my double-pane glass needs replacement?
If you discover condensation between the panes or misting that doesn’t clear, the seal might be broken, and expert replacement is typically required.
3. What kind of adhesive should I use for glass repair?
Utilize a professional-grade glass adhesive for repairing chips. For bigger replacements, silicone sealant is ideal for sealing the edges.
4. Is it worth repairing small fractures?
Yes, repairing minor cracks can prolong the life of the door glass and prevent further damage while saving money on replacement costs.
5. What should I do if the glass is shattered?
If the glass is shattered, it is best to replace the panel entirely due to safety issues and the capacity for injury from jagged edges.
